The Office of Wellness and Mental Health (OWMH) has compiled a list of free training opportunities for NOVA faculty and staff. To support the development of NOVA’s culture of care, OWMH aims to provide increased options for the growth of skills related to spotting the signs of student distress, and available resources to support student wellness. Additionally, OWMH seeks to support and encourage the wellness of NOVA staff and faculty. Making it a priority to acknowledge the needs of members of the NOVA community is a team effort and serves the goals of prevention and early intervention. These trainings are both on-demand (view as you go) and live via web video, and registration may be required. More trainings will be shared as they become available.
